    minnowposted 7 years ago

    where is Noida and what is NCR?  thanks

    ayush.kumarposted 7 years ago

    Noida is a fast-developing town located adjacent to New Delhi, India. Since New Delhi is the capital of India, towns surrounding it (like Noida, Ghaziabad) are said to be in the 'NCR', that is, National Capital Region.  Hope this helps.

    shailendraacdposted 7 years ago

    Its close to Delhi and located in Uattar Pradesh, India, NCR, the National Capital Region of Delh including Faridabad, Gurgaon, NOIDA, Faridabad

